WINNING: Vanity Fair Reveals Silly Nostalgia for Democrat Fantasy of 'The West Wing'
Newsbusters ^ | September 22, 2019 | P.J. Gladnick

Posted on 09/22/2019 8:21:10 AM PDT by PJ-Comix

President Jed Bartlet, you were just too good for us. 

It has long been known that liberals hold the television show The West Wing in a high esteem that feeds into their fantasies, especially in times where cold reality has not exactly gone as they (and creator Aaron Sorkin) would have hoped.  And this fantasy will only be intensified since this is the twentieth anniversary of the show's premiere. Another reason for liberals to fantasize ever more deeply in the parallel liberal world of The West Wing is obviously due to the the one they consider to be the intruder in the real world West Wing, President Donald Trump.

The September 20 Vanity Fair article by Sonya Saraiya, "How The West Wing Briefly Made Democrats Into TV Winners," reveals how liberals continue looking upon that show as a source of solace over the years and especially now in the midst of the Trumpocalypse.
